The beam calculator allows for the analysis of stresses and deflections in straight beams.

The 2D Finite Element Analysis (FEA) calculator can be used to analyze any structure that can be modeled with 2D beams.

The bolted joint calculator allows for stress analysis of a bolted joint, accounting for preload, applied axial load, and applied shear load.

The bolt torque calculator can be used to calculate the torque required to achieve the desired preload on a bolted joint.

The bolt pattern calculator allows for applied forces to be distributed over bolts in a pattern.

The lug calculator allows for analysis of lifting lugs under axial, transverse, or oblique loading.

The column buckling calculator allows for buckling analysis of long and intermediate-length columns loaded in compression.

The Mohr's circle calculator provides an intuitive way of visualizing the state of stress at a point in a loaded material.
